| Kopleff Recital Hall, 10 Peachtree Center Avenue, Atlanta 30303, United States Friday 12-Feb-10 20:00 Mauricio Kagel: Film Music, Music Performance, Performance Film Mauricio Kagel, the German-Argentine composer who died in 2008, is most noted for his theatrical contributions to classical music performance. The evening will offer two of Kagel's short films, Unter Strom and Antithese, and performances of Kagel's Schattenklange for bass clarinet and Match for Two Cellos and Percussion. Match is a dialogue for two celli with a percussionist serving as the umpire. It is not only a match in sounds, but also in physical reactions, keeping the umpire busy! Performed by Bent Frequency-a professional, contemporary chamber music ensemble based in Atlanta-and in collaboration with Frequent Small Meals of Atlanta. | Hampstead Town Hall, 213 Haverstock Hill, London, London NW3 4PQ, United Kingdom Saturday 20-Feb-10 19:00 Phil Best playing improvised piano accompaniment to groundbreaking silent film This promises to be a rare treat for lovers of both beautiful piano playing and cinema history. The pianist Phil Best is a gifted improviser and welcomes this rare opportunity to improvise the piano accompaniment to 'Different From The Others', one of cinema's most ground-breaking films. Made in 1919 this German film is one of the first gay-themed films in the history of cinema. It was banned on its release and then later burned by the Nazis. Created by Magnus Hirschfeld and Richard Oswald, the film explores the criminalisation of gay men in Germany via the infamous paragraph 175 of the criminal code, and in spite of its difficult subject, it is ahead of its time in carrying a positive message in support of gay men.
